Transaction dcf693ef5838a4180365193e4b8914385570c11abe08bfa467831d379e949309
1 Input
2 Outputs
- dcf693ef5838a4180365193e4b8914385570c11abe08bfa467831d379e949309:0
- dcf693ef5838a4180365193e4b8914385570c11abe08bfa467831d379e949309:1
value 9875000
address 1KvVCGiYTefs1UgWQ2ad8KQsB334wEQoTh
value 649607897
address 15duFvxekTT5iaUZZRXb5aCj9y48Yxaarb